Create a test harness app and component
Let's get set up for doing development right now. You'll create a test harness Lightning application, and add a simple component to it. Then you'll verify that you can see changes in the component.
- Create a new Lightning component named myFirstComponent
- Add this static text to the component: I solemnly swear I know JavaScript
- Create a new Lightning application named harnessApp
- Add myFirstComponent to the harness app with this markup: <c:myFirstComponent/>
- Click the Preview button and verify your text is displayed
- Make a change to the static text so it reads: I am proficient in JavaScript
- Click the Preview button again and verify your change is displayed

Challenge completed...
1.Create a “Harness” App
2.Create Lightning Component Name is 'myFirstComponent'
<aura:component implements="flexipage:availableForRecordHome,force:hasRecordId" access="global" >
I am proficient in JavaScript
</aura:component>
3.Create Lightning Component App Name is "harnessApp"
<aura:application extends="force:slds" >
<c:myFirstComponent/>
</aura:application>
4.Then After Preview
Challenge Successfully
